Output 0f76560e38389e49b801f5c984ef6901b29c75aed4d131bfd99e27602de465a8:1

value
37603390729
script pubkey
OP_0 OP_PUSHBYTES_20 51da619ed3807308e89e22201cb9cf21aee69b77
address
ltc1q28dxr8knspes36y7ygspeww0yxhwdxmhp6fzl3
transaction
0f76560e38389e49b801f5c984ef6901b29c75aed4d131bfd99e27602de465a8
spent
true